Etymology[edit]

xyro- (razor) +‎ spasm

Noun[edit]

xyrospasm

  1. (rare) A spasm experienced whilst attempting to use a shaving razor.
    • 1904, Hermann Oppenheim, Diseases of the Nervous System, J.B. Lippincott Co., page 859:
      I have seen in two cases a barbers’ cramp (keirospasm or xyrospasm) — i.e., a spastic contraction of the muscles of the hand and fingers, which came on in a barber at every attempt to use a razor.
